FAQs about Mercure Hotel Severinshof Köln City

Is parking available at the property?

Self parking is available on-site for a fee of EUR 21 per day, which includes in/out privileges. Parking height restrictions apply.


What type of breakfast is offered and what are the serving hours?

A buffet breakfast is served on weekdays from 6:30 AM to 10:30 AM and on weekends from 6:30 AM to 11:00 AM for a fee of approximately EUR 24 per person.


What are the standard check-in and check-out times?

Check-in is from 3:00 PM to 2:00 AM, and check-out is until 12:00 PM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request and could incur additional charges.

What accessibility features are available for guests with disabilities?

The property offers step-free entrances and wheelchair-accessible facilities, including public areas and rooms. Additional features may include accessible bathrooms.


Where is the property located in relation to key landmarks?

The hotel is centrally located in Cologne, within a 15-minute walk of Wallraf-Richartz Museum and Old Market. It is approximately 1.1 miles from Cologne Cathedral and City Hall. Public transport options are available nearby.
